Description
Summary:Abstract Formation of a huge amount of industrial waste is one of the most urgent problems of the mineral resource complex today. It accumulates on the surface of the Earth, disposed of by burning or stored in anthropogenic arrays, thereby providing a complex and lasting negative impact on all components of the natural environment. This problem is especially acute in regions with a high concentration of enterprises of the mineral resource complex. The results of a scientific study on monitoring the state of the floodplain ecosystems of the Ob River, as one of the most reliable indicators of the intensification of the anthropogenic load in the region, are presents in the article. The progress of the research and the results of computer processing of the data are described in the article in detail. In addition, comparative characteristics of the state of some species of plant communities over a three-year period are given.
